1. Bills & Resolutions
(CONDEMNING ANTI-PALESTINIAN HATE) S. Res. 529 [resolution text]: Introduced 12/4/25 by Welch (D-VT) and Sanders (I-VT), “A resolution condemning anti-Palestinian hatred on the anniversary of the attack in Burlington, Vermont, on November 25, 2023.” Referred to the Committee on the Judiciary. Also see: press release – Welch Introduces Resolution Condemning Anti-Palestinian Hate
UPDATE – (TARGETING HAMAS & ANYONE ASSOCIATED WITH HAMAS) HR 176: Introduced 1/3/25 by McClintock (R-CA) and now having 19 cosponsor (all Republicans), “To amend the Immigration and Nationality Act with respect to aliens who carried out, participated in, planned, financed, supported, or otherwise facilitated the attacks against Israel”, aka the “No Immigration Benefits for Hamas Terrorists Act” [see: 2/27/25: Blackburn, Rosen Introduce “No Immigration Benefits for Hamas Terrorists Act”]. HR 176 was marked up in the House Judiciary Committee on 2/26/25 [see Committee press release 2/26/25 – No Immigration Benefits for Hamas Terrorists Act (H.R. 176) Passes House Judiciary Committee] reported out of Committee on 3/21/25 [with H. Rept. 119-27], and placed on the Union Calendar (paving the way for a floor vote). UPDATE: Passed by the House 12/1/25 by voice vote. Also see:

(NO MORE DUAL CITIZENSHIP!) S. 3283 [bill text]: Introduced 12/1/25 by Moreno (R-OH) and no cosponsors, “A bill to establish that citizens of the United States shall owe sole and exclusive allegiance to the United States, and for other purposes” aka the “Exclusive Citizenship Act of 2025“. Referred to the Committee on the Judiciary. NOTE: this bill does not include any exceptions, meaning, among other things, it would apply to the estimated hundreds of thousands of dual US-Israel citizens (living in both countries); the bill notably does not deal with Americans citizens serving in foreign militaries. (INTERNET FREEDOM FOR IRAN) HR 6469 // S. 3360 [bill text]: Introduced 12/4/25 in the House by Min (D-CA) and 12 bipartisan cosponsors, and in the Senate by Rosen (D-NV) and McCormick (R-PA), “To require a report on internet freedom in Iran.” Referred to the House Committee on Foreign Affairs and the Senate Committee on Foreign Relations. (PUNISH NYC/MAMDANI BY RE-LOCATING THE UN) HR 6395 [bill text]: Introduced 12/3/25 by Jackson (R-TX) and 2 Republican cosponsors, “To implement a strategy to relocate the headquarters of the United Nations, and for other purposes.” Referred to the House Committee on Foreign Affairs. (CONDEMNING IRAN’S TREATMENT OF THE BAHA’I) H. Res. 925/ S. Res. 525: Introduced 12/3/25 in the House by Shakowsky (D-IL) and 21 bipartisan cosponsors, and in the Senate by Wyden (D-OR) and 20 bipartisan cosponsors, “Condemning the Government of Iran’s state-sponsored persecution of the Baha’i minority in Iran and the continued violation of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ights and the International Covenant on Civil and Political Rights.“ Referred to the House Committee on Foreign Affairs and the Senate Foreign Relations Committee. December 3, 2025: The Senate Foreign Relations Committee held a Business Meeting, at which -among other things, the Committee voted to advance to the full Senate the controversial nomination of Rabbi Yehuda Kaploun to be Special Envoy to Monitor and Combat Anti-Semitism. Also see: Senate Foreign Relations Committee backs Kaploun’s nomination as antisemitism envoy [“All the committee’s Republicans and two Democrats — Sens. Jeanne Shaheen and Jacky Rosen — voted in favor”] (Jewish Insider 12/3/25). For details from his original nomination hearing, see the 11/21/25 edition of the Round-Up. - Jewish Insider 12/3/25: Sen. Van Hollen attacks Maryland Jewish community liaison Ron Halber as Netanyahu ‘apologist’
- NOTE: This Jewish Insider’s headline is either indefensibly sloppy or deliberately misleading (and the fact that JI has elected, as of this writing, to not fix it suggests the latter), as are those breathlessly repeating it in outrage.
- According to the actual text of the article, Senator Van Hollen did not say anything about Halber. Rather, the headline attributes to Van Hollen a statement by one of his spokespeople (unidentified). Also, as reported in the article, the spokesperson did not “attack” Halber, but was responding (presumably to a query from JI) to a public attack Halber made on Van Hollen, and doing so in a manner that, compared to Halber’s remarks, was remarkably restrained and diplomatic
- Excerpt from the JI article of Halber’s attack on Van Hollen: “Sen. Van Hollen, I think, has dramatically lost his way with support for Israel. He’s become the leading senator agitating against Israel in the United States Senate…His social media is filled with a lack of empathy for Jewish suffering. It’s filled with a lack of empathy for Israel’s strategic position. It’s almost like [he] cannot wait for the next opportunity to jump down Israel’s throat…I’m very upset about it, and so are many people in this room, because that’s not the Sen. Van Hollen that so many people in this room worked hard to get elected…On the issue of Israel, I would say the overwhelming majority of the Jewish community feels betrayed by the senator.”]
